Mary Reilly is a lonely servant in the home of Dr Henry Jekyll, devoted to her position and her master. Slowly, a gradual friendship between Mary and the doctor begins as well as a growing attraction. However, Mary's quiet presence is thrown upside down when she meets Henry Jekyll's assistant, the handsome but enigmatic Edward Hyde. Although initially repelled, Mary soon finds herself drawn towards his passionate nature. But Edward Hyde is not all he seems...

Movie Trivia:
- John Malkovich, who plays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de, previously appeared in The Object of Beauty (1991), in which his character complains of too many film adaptations of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de.
-
After the production was given the green light, Tim Burton was set to direct this but, after receiving the script for Ed Wood (1994), he chose to direct that instead.
-
Although the crew originally shot an ending similar to the book's (an anticlimax in which Jekyll dies and Mary lies beside him), there were no fewer than 25 rewrites. In winter 1995, months after Mary Reilly's production team had disbanded, the producers called back the stars to shoot three alternative endings. For one of them, Glenn Close was flown back to London on the Concorde for one day of work.
-
Jack Nicholson was considered to play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de. Emmanuelle Seigner was considered to play the title role and Roman Polanski was originally directing, but the package fell apart.
-
Julia Roberts beat Uma Thurman to the lead role, for a $10 million paycheck.
